64 Cu-DOTA-alendronate PET Imaging in Localizing and Characterizing Breast Calcifications in Participants Before Undergoing Mastectomy

This early phase I pilot trial studies how well 64Cu-DOTA-alendronate positron emission tomography (PET) imaging work in localizing and characterizing breast calcifications (small calcium deposits) in participants before undergoing mastectomy. Diagnostic procedures, such 64Cu-DOTA-alendronate PET, may detect calcification and help doctors predict cancer associated calcification within breast tissue.

About this study

PRIMARY OBJECTIVES:

I. To evaluate the uptake (maximum standardized uptake value [SUVmax]) of 64Cu-DOTA-alendronate in female patients with biopsy-proven malignant breast calcifications.

SECONDARY OBJECTIVES:

I. To compare uptake of 64Cu-DOTA-alendronate on PET -computed tomography (CT) with histology after mastectomy.

OUTLINE: This is a dose-escalation study of 64Cu-DOTA-alendronate.

Participants receive 64Cu-DOTA-alendronate intravenously (IV) and undergo PET/CT imaging 60 minutes after injection. Participants with sufficient levels of residual radioactivity may undergo repeat imaging on day 1 as determined by the study team.

After completion of study , participants are followed up for 7 days.

Inclusion criteria

  • Evidence of calcifications on mammogram
  • Biopsy confirmed malignancy associated calcifications in at least one breast
  • Biopsy confirmed benign calcifications in at least one breast (same or contralateral breast)
  • Planned total mastectomy for treatment
  • Ability to provide informed consent
  • Negative serum pregnancy test
  • No evidence of impaired hepatic or kidney function

Exclusion criteria

  • Participants who do not have residual calcifications present on mammogram following biopsy
  • Concurrent malignancy other than non-melanoma skin cancer
  • Patients with known metastatic disease
  • Patients who have received prior treatment for the current breast cancer
  • Patients currently using oral bisphosphonate therapy
  • Patients with injection of other radioactive material within 90 days
  • Inability to provide informed consent
  • Pregnant or lactating patients
  • Patients with impaired kidney function (creatinine >= 1.3 mg/dL or < 0.6 mg/dL)
